Course Outline

Introduction to DeepSeek Harness

  • Overview of DeepSeek Harness and its place in the ecosystem
  • The design philosophy of “everything is a plugin”
  • Overview of Web UI, CLI, and headless modes

Setup and Initial Launch

  • Node.js prerequisites and package setup
  • Starting the Web UI using npx
  • Compiling and running from source code

Configuring Models

  • Configuring the DeepSeek API key
  • Choosing and switching between models
  • Integrating OpenAI-compatible endpoints

Managing Workspaces and Sessions

  • Selecting and switching between workspaces
  • Using the session composer for conversation management
  • Reading, modifying, and generating code files

Executing Coding Tasks

  • Summarizing repositories and navigating codebases
  • Executing commands and distributing tasks
  • Maintaining and updating task plans

Permissions and Sandbox Management

  • Defining approval and permission policies
  • Restricting file and command access
  • Configuring local and remote sandbox backends

Native Tools and Integrations

  • Utilizing filesystem, terminal, and shell utilities
  • Supporting the Model Context Protocol
  • Integrating with the Language Server Protocol

Subagents and Task Delegation

  • Creating and forking subagents
  • Product providers for alternative coding agents
  • Distributing work across active sessions

The Cordis Plugin Architecture

  • Plugins functioning as services, events, and effects
  • Shared context and lifecycle management
  • Understanding the absence of a privileged core

Profiles, Bundles, and Configuration

  • Layering profiles and bundles
  • Modifying configuration via cordis.patch.yml
  • Inspecting the boot process tree

Essential Subsystems

  • The append-only session log mechanism
  • Assembling system prompts and tool schemas
  • Understanding the agent loop and turn flow

Event Handling and Extension Points

  • Handling session, agent, and capability events
  • Waterfall and interceptor event patterns
  • Aligning behaviors with specific extension points

Plugin Development

  • Registering services using context keys
  • Incorporating tools and model adapters
  • Distributing and locating plugins

SDK, Headless Mode, and Automation

  • Controlling the harness from external processes
  • Using TypeScript and Python SDKs
  • Automating workflows via CLI and headless mode

Requirements

  • Familiarity with core software development principles
  • Proficiency with command-line interfaces and Git
  • Basic knowledge of JavaScript or TypeScript

Target Audience

  • Software developers
  • AI and machine learning engineers
  • DevOps and platform engineers
